Rosendale
Rosendale is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$62,536. Population has grown 15% since 2000. Median home value is $147,400. Poverty is rare here, at 3.4% of residents.

How many people live in Rosendale, Wisconsin?
Rosendale, Wisconsin has about 1,063 residents according to the 2010 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Rosendale, Wisconsin?
The typical household in Rosendale, Wisconsin earns about $62,536 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Rosendale, Wisconsin expensive?
In Rosendale, Wisconsin, the median home is worth about $147,400, and the typical rent is about $575 a month.
How educated are people in Rosendale, Wisconsin?
About 20.7% of adults age 25 and over in Rosendale, Wisconsin h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Rosendale, Wisconsin?
About 3.4% of people in Rosendale, Wisconsin live below the federal poverty line.
Has Rosendale, Wisconsin grown since 1990?
Yes, Rosendale, Wisconsin has grown since 1990. The population has added about 294 residents, a change of about 38 percent over that period.
